News Summary

Dallas Cowboys quarterback Dak Prescott and his fiancée, Sarah Jane Ramos, reportedly ended their relationship about a month before their planned wedding. Reports suggest that their relationship had been experiencing difficulties, which came to a head during their joint bachelor and bachelorette parties. Ramos posted on social media about the support of her friends and shared images from recent trips and her bridal shower, notably without Prescott's presence. The couple had been engaged since October 2024 and share two children together. There has been no official comment from Prescott or his representatives regarding the breakup.

Biblical Reflection

From a biblical perspective, the end of an engagement—especially when children are involved—is a moment of pain and disappointment, not only for the couple but for those around them. Scripture upholds the sanctity of marriage (Genesis 2:24, Ephesians 5:22-33) and encourages faithfulness, commitment, and reconciliation. However, it also recognizes the brokenness of human relationships in a fallen world. The public nature of this breakup, amplified by social media and celebrity culture, can tempt us toward judgment, gossip, or taking sides. Instead, Christians are called to approach such news with empathy, prayer, and a heart for healing. We must remember that true reconciliation and wholeness come from Christ, and that grace is needed in difficult situations—especially for the children affected. This is a time to reflect on the values of forgiveness, humility, and the importance of seeking God's guidance in relationships.
